Infiniti's Presence in Europe

Now, before we zoom in on the Netherlands, let’s get a broader view of Infiniti’s presence in Europe. Generally speaking, Infiniti has had a somewhat limited footprint in the European market. While the brand aimed to establish itself as a premium alternative to established European luxury brands like BMW, Mercedes-Benz, and Audi, it faced several challenges. These included stiff competition, different consumer preferences, and the complexities of meeting European regulatory standards. As a result, Infiniti eventually decided to withdraw from the European market in 2020. This decision meant halting sales of new Infiniti vehicles, including models like the Q30, QX30, and others that were specifically tailored for the European market. However, this doesn't mean that Infiniti cars are completely absent from European roads. Some owners still drive their Infiniti vehicles, and there are service centers that continue to support these cars. But, if you're looking to buy a brand-new Infiniti in Europe, you might hit a dead end. Knowing this context is crucial as we narrow our focus to the Netherlands and the specific case of the QX80. Is the Infiniti QX80 Available in the Netherlands?

So, here’s the million-dollar question: Can you actually buy an Infiniti QX80 in the Netherlands? The short answer is: officially, no. As I mentioned earlier, Infiniti pulled out of the European market, which includes the Netherlands. This means that Infiniti doesn't have official dealerships or sales operations in the country anymore. However, don't lose hope just yet! There are a couple of ways you might still get your hands on a QX80. One option is to import a QX80 from another market, such as the United States or the Middle East, where the vehicle is still sold. This process can be a bit complicated, as it involves dealing with import regulations, taxes, and ensuring the vehicle meets European safety and emissions standards. Another possibility is to look for a used Infiniti QX80 that was previously imported into the Netherlands. You might find one through private sellers or specialized car dealerships that deal with imported vehicles. Keep in mind that buying a used car always comes with some risks, so it's essential to do your homework and thoroughly inspect the vehicle before making a purchase. In summary, while it's not impossible to own an Infiniti QX80 in the Netherlands, it's definitely not as straightforward as buying one from a local dealership. You'll need to be prepared to do some extra legwork and navigate the complexities of importing or buying a used vehicle.

Why is the QX80 Not Officially Sold in the Netherlands?

You might be wondering, why isn't the QX80 officially sold in the Netherlands? Well, there are several factors at play. Firstly, the European car market is highly competitive, with many established luxury brands already vying for customers. Infiniti struggled to gain significant market share, and the QX80, being a large SUV, didn't quite align with the preferences of many European car buyers who tend to favor smaller, more fuel-efficient vehicles. Secondly, European regulations are quite strict when it comes to emissions and safety standards. Adapting the QX80 to meet these standards would have required significant investment, which Infiniti may not have deemed worthwhile given its overall performance in the European market. Thirdly, the cost of importing and selling vehicles in Europe can be quite high, with various taxes and fees adding to the final price. This could have made the QX80 less competitive compared to other luxury SUVs already available in the Netherlands. Lastly, consumer preferences play a big role. Many Dutch car buyers prioritize fuel efficiency and environmental friendliness, which are not the QX80's strongest suits. All these factors combined likely contributed to Infiniti's decision not to officially sell the QX80 in the Netherlands. It's a matter of market dynamics, regulatory requirements, and consumer demand.

Importing a QX80: What to Consider

Okay, so you're still dreaming about that QX80, huh? If you're seriously considering importing one into the Netherlands, there are a few key things you need to keep in mind to avoid any nasty surprises along the way. First off, get ready to tackle some paperwork. Importing a car involves a fair bit of bureaucracy, including customs declarations, import duties, and VAT (Value Added Tax). Make sure you understand all the requirements and have all the necessary documents in order before you start the process. Next, you'll need to ensure that the QX80 meets European safety and emissions standards. This might require some modifications to the vehicle, such as changes to the lighting system or exhaust system. You'll also need to obtain a European Certificate of Conformity (COC) to prove that the vehicle complies with these standards. Shipping the QX80 to the Netherlands will also incur significant costs, including transportation fees, insurance, and handling charges. Be sure to get quotes from several shipping companies and factor these costs into your budget. Once the vehicle arrives in the Netherlands, you'll need to register it with the Dutch vehicle registration authority (RDW). This involves a technical inspection to ensure that the vehicle is roadworthy and complies with all regulations. Finally, don't forget about insurance. You'll need to obtain car insurance from a Dutch insurance company before you can legally drive the QX80 on Dutch roads. Importing a car can be a complex and time-consuming process, so it's essential to do your research and seek professional advice if needed.
